Ticket VLT-providence: vault locked after failed rotation.

New folks: soft deletes in the orders table set deleted_at, nothing is purged. The cleanup job in Orbiter stalled because the vault sealed mid-rotation. Don't hard-delete anything manually. To unseal, use the break-glass flow. The passphrase for recovery is on the next line.

unlock words, fajof-tahog: istix-zordor-joreth-gilix

# Loading Dock — Delivery Hours

The Tarnell Building loading dock accepts deliveries 07:00–15:30, weekdays only. Couriers must sign in at the dock office; no pallets left unattended. Oversized deliveries need 24 hours' notice to facilities. After 15:30 the roller door locks automatically. New starters collecting personal deliveries should go to the dock office and present the access code below.

badge for yajep-tawip: bdg-UBYAH-39947

# NOTE for future maintainers: this client targets the new Brimveil
# broker (v4), migrated from the old Cobblemq cluster last quarter.
# Connection retries are handled by the broker SDK now, so don't
# re-add the manual backoff loop — it caused duplicate publishes.
# Auth moved from mTLS to static keys during the upgrade. The key
# for the internal Brimveil gateway is defined on the next line.

API key for yahig-tadup: kto7_ubizbYm

TICKET-902: Deep links land on home screen

App: Wrenfield mobile (v5.2)
Severity: P2

Repro:
1. Cold-start the app killed.
2. Tap a `wrenfield://orders/detail` link.
3. Router drops the path; home screen loads.

Warm app routes fine. Suspect the splash handler swallows the intent. Replay links against staging with the bearer token below.

session JWT of yawep-yawep = eyJhbGciOiJIUzI1NiIsInR5cCI6IkpXVCJ9.eyJzdWIiOiI3pWF3_In0.aXYsHiog